Graduation Rate
The following chart shows the graduation rate of Universal Technical Institute-Southern California students who enrolled in 2018 and after. The stat covers all undergraduates registered as full-time students to study a 4-year bachelor's degree program for the first time.
The breakdown shows the graduation rate by race/ethnicity of US students. All international students are represented under one group.
As of August 31, 2021, the average graduation rate of Universal Technical Institute-Southern California students is 48.6%. Female students graduated at a rate of 47.4%, whereas male students graduated at a rate of 48.7%.
48.6%
- asian 72.7% 16 students
- African American 41.2% 7 students
- white 59.2% 42 students
- unknown 42.9% 6 students
- hawaiian 66.7% 2 students
- hispanic 44.5% 179 students
- Mixed Race 59.6% 28 students
Drop Out
Universal Technical Institute-Southern California has an overall drop-out rate of 40.2% as of August 31, 2021. The dropout rate of male students and female students is 40.1% and 42.1% respectively.
Below is a breakdown of the dropout rate of US students by race/ethnicity and international students.
40.2%
- asian 22.7% 5 students
- African American 52.9% 9 students
- white 32.4% 23 students
- unknown 50.0% 7 students
- hispanic 42.5% 171 students
- Mixed Race 31.9% 15 students
